Chex Candy Clusters

"This recipe is from the www.bettycrocker.com website. "Love snacks that are both sweet and salty? Here is a quick-to-make treat for you!" Here are some notes from the Betty Crocker Kitchen: Time Saver - Use your microwave to melt the candy coating. Place the chunks in a 4-cup microwavable measuring cup or 1-quart microwavable casserole. Microwave uncovered on High 1 minute 30 seconds to 2 minutes 30 seconds, stirring every 30 seconds, until almost melted, then stir until smooth. Success - If you have an extra set of hands in the kitchen, your helper can mix the dry ingredients while you melt the candy coating and chocolate chips, then can help break up the treat after it sets. Substitution - Peanuts make an easy stand-in for the cashews."

ingredients

  • 4 cups Rice Chex
  • 2 cups pretzel sticks, coarsely broken
  • 1 cup cashews, coarsely chopped
  • 0.5 (16 ounce) package vanilla candy coating (almond bark)
  • 12 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

directions

  • Spray with cooking spray or grease 13x9-inch pan. In large bowl, mix cereal, pretzels and cashews.
  • In 2-quart saucepan, melt candy coating over low heat, stirring constantly. Pour over cereal mixture, stirring until evenly coated. Press in pan; cool slightly.
  • In microwavable bowl, microwave chocolate chips uncovered on High about 1 minute or until chocolate can be stirred smooth (bowl will be hot). Drizzle chocolate over snack. Let stand about 30 minutes or until chocolate is set. Break into clusters. Store in airtight container.
